AlgoSynergy Pulse - осциллятор силы движения цены для MT5
AlgoSynergy Pulse - осциллятор для MetaTrader 5, измеряющий энергию (силу) движения цены. Ядро - моментум, нормированный на ATR, в единой шкале [-1;+1]: гистограмма энергии, два MA-фильтра, стрелки по тренду и маркеры «заряд» и «энергия гаснет». Сигналы на закрытом баре, без перерисовки в моменте. Математика полностью открыта - не клон чужого осциллятора.

Дискреционный помощник, не торговый робот: показывает силу хода и подсказывает действие, но сделки не открывает. Инструмент «Лаборатории», форвард-проверка в процессе. Обновлено: 21.06.2026. Автор: Александр Тригуб.
Что это и кому подходит
Awesome Oscillator, Accelerator, Momentum - все они меряют импульс по чужим готовым формулам и в сырых ценовых единицах, из-за чего на золоте по 4000 и на паре по 1.1 их значения несопоставимы. AlgoSynergy Pulse решает это иначе: импульс делится на ATR, поэтому шкала [-1;+1] одинакова на любом инструменте, а формула открыта целиком - видно, как считается каждый шаг.
Подходит тем, кто хочет видеть не «выше/ниже нуля», а насколько сильно и резко идёт цена, входит на откате по тренду и предпочитает прозрачную математику вместо «чёрного ящика». Рабочий инструмент - золото (XAUUSD) на M5, но за счёт нормировки индикатор осмыслен на крипте, индексах и валютах.
Как считается энергия (формула открыта)
Никакого «чёрного ящика». На каждом баре цепочка такая:
1. r = Close - Close[1] // движение за бар 2. e = r / ATR(14) // энергия бара (нормирована волатильностью) 3. Hist = EMA(e, 10) // сглаженная знаковая энергия 4. Hist = Hist / max|Hist| на окне 200 → шкала [-1; +1] 5. MA_fast = EMA(Hist, 5), MA_slow = EMA(Hist, 12) // фильтр
Смысл по шагам: деление на ATR превращает «8 пунктов» в осмысленную величину - много это или мало, зависит не от цены актива, а от того, насколько он обычно ходит. EMA-сглаживание убирает шум. Адаптивная нормализация на окне приводит результат к диапазону [-1;+1], где уровни постоянны и читаются одинаково везде. Два MA по гистограмме - это «усреднённая энергия», фильтр направления.
Пример наглядно: ход бара +8 пунктов при ATR 400 даёт сырую энергию около 0.02; после сглаживания и нормировки на максимум окна она превращается в значение шкалы [-1;+1], которое прямо сравнимо с любым другим инструментом.
Что на экране
- Гистограмма энергии - зелёная при положительной энергии, красная при отрицательной (знак = направление хода).
- MA_fast и MA_slow - две средние по гистограмме, их взаимное положение = фильтр.
- Уровни 0, +/-0.5 (заряд), +/-0.95 (экстремум) - постоянные благодаря нормировке.
- Панель ДЕЙСТВИЕ - готовый вердикт по последнему закрытому бару (см. ниже).
Сигналы и что они значат
Стрелка по тренду
Появляется на закрытом баре, когда энергия пересекла ноль в сторону тренда, прошла порог силы и MA согласованы. Дедуп «до встречной»: одна стрелка на серию, пока не сменится направление. Это вход по набравшему энергию движению, а не угадывание разворота.
Вертикаль - заряд энергии
Ставится, когда модуль энергии впервые достигает уровня 0.5 при согласованных MA: движение набрало силу. Сигнал готовности, а не входа сам по себе.
Маркер - энергия гаснет
Точка появляется, когда при неизменном знаке и энергия, и её средняя одновременно разворачиваются к нулю: ход выдыхается. Подсказка подтянуть стоп или зафиксировать часть.
Почему работает на любом инструменте
Это главное отличие от Awesome Oscillator и Momentum. Те считают импульс в абсолютных единицах цены, поэтому их шкала «плавает» от инструмента к инструменту, и уровни теряют смысл. Pulse делит импульс на ATR - меру того, насколько инструмент обычно ходит. В результате шкала [-1;+1] и уровни 0.5 / 0.95 означают одно и то же на золоте, биткойне, индексе и валютной паре. Кросс-инструментальность здесь не лозунг «любые пары», а следствие математики.
Панель «ДЕЙСТВИЕ»
Фирменная возможность, которой нет у стандартных осцилляторов: панель синтезирует состояние энергии в один вердикт по последнему закрытому бару.
- ВХОД - свежая стрелка по тренду.
- ЗАРЯД - энергия набрана (>= 0.5), MA согласованы.
- ЭКСТРЕМ - движение перегрето (>= 0.95).
- ДЕРЖАТЬ - знак держится, MA согласованы, энергия выше порога.
- ГАСНЕТ - энергия выдыхается, пора подтянуть стоп.
- ЖДАТЬ - нейтраль или MA против.
Чем отличается от Awesome Oscillator, Momentum и MACD
| Свойство | AlgoSynergy Pulse | Awesome Oscillator | Momentum | MACD |
|---|---|---|---|---|
| Математика | моментум / ATR, EMA | SMA(5) - SMA(34) медиан | Close / Close[n] x 100 | EMA(12) - EMA(26) |
| Нормировка / шкала | [-1;+1] через ATR | сырые единицы цены | проценты | сырые единицы |
| Кросс-инструментальность | да (by-design) | нет | условно | нет |
| Готовые сигналы (стрелки/заряд/гаснет) | да | нет (только гистограмма) | нет (линия) | нет (линии) |
| Вердикт ДЕЙСТВИЕ | да | нет | нет | нет |
| Прозрачность формулы | открыта целиком | стандарт | стандарт | стандарт |
Как использовать
Pulse - триггер и контекст силы хода, а не самостоятельная система. Под стиль «вход на откате»: дождаться, пока энергия наберётся (заряд) и пойдёт по тренду, входить на откате в сторону движения, подтягивать стоп при сигнале «гаснет». Решение подтверждать трендом старшего плана и структурой. Это дискреционный помощник - сделки он не открывает.
Честные ограничения
- Лаг сглаживания. EMA и ATR дают задержку - цена отсутствия дёрганья на каждом тике. Осциллятор показывает набранную энергию, а не предсказывает её появление.
- Шкала адаптивная, а не абсолютная. Гистограмма нормируется на причинном окне (последние N баров до текущего включительно), поэтому высота столбика - это энергия ОТНОСИТЕЛЬНО недавнего диапазона, а не абсолютная величина: один и тот же ход в разных режимах волатильности может читаться по-разному. Закрытые бары при этом не перерисовываются - окно причинное, меняется только текущий формирующийся бар, как у любого осциллятора.
- Это осциллятор, а не грааль. В сильном тренде он подолгу держит экстремум, на флэте чаще шумит. Фильтруйте контекстом.
- Это помощник, не робот. Показывает и подсказывает, но не торгует. Решение и риск - на вас.
Место в системе AlgoSynergy
Pulse - инструмент «Лаборатории»: новое измерение силы хода рядом с консенсусом таймфреймов GOLD, импульсной стрелкой SuperArrow и структурой Structure. Как несколько сигналов собираются в одно правило входа - в методологии.
Технические требования
- Платформа: MetaTrader 5 (любой брокер).
- Инструмент: любой (ATR-нормировка); рабочий - золото (XAUUSD) на M5, осмыслен на крипте/индексах/валютах.
- Тип: индикатор отдельного окна (подвал), параметры открыты и настраиваемы.
Частые вопросы
Что такое осциллятор импульса простыми словами?
Это индикатор в отдельном окне, который показывает силу и направление движения цены: насколько резко и далеко цена идёт, а не просто «вверх или вниз». AlgoSynergy Pulse меряет эту энергию как моментум, делённый на ATR, и приводит к понятной шкале от -1 до +1.
Чем Pulse отличается от Awesome Oscillator?
Awesome Oscillator считает импульс как разницу двух средних в сырых единицах цены, поэтому его шкала несопоставима между инструментами. Pulse делит импульс на ATR и нормирует в [-1;+1] - одна шкала на золоте, крипте и валютах. Плюс у Pulse есть готовые сигналы и вердикт ДЕЙСТВИЕ, которых у AO нет.
Индикатор перерисовывает сигналы?
Нет. Сигналы (стрелки, заряд, гаснет) и сама гистограмма фиксируются на закрытом баре и после закрытия не двигаются: нормализация считается на причинном окне - только бары до текущего включительно, - поэтому новый экстремум энергии не переписывает прошлые столбики. Меняется лишь текущий формирующийся бар, пока свеча не закрылась, - как у любого осциллятора.
Почему он работает на любом инструменте?
Из-за деления на ATR. ATR - мера того, насколько инструмент обычно ходит, поэтому импульс, поделённый на него, становится безразмерным. Шкала [-1;+1] и уровни 0.5 / 0.95 значат одно и то же на золоте, биткойне, индексе и валютной паре.
Что значат уровни 0.5 и 0.95?
0.5 (L1) - порог «заряда»: энергия набрана, движение состоялось. 0.95 (L2) - экстремум: ход перегрет, риск отката выше. Благодаря нормировке эти уровни постоянны и читаются одинаково на любом инструменте.
Чем энергия в Pulse отличается от RSI или Stochastic?
RSI и Stochastic меряют перекупленность/перепроданность относительно недавнего диапазона. Pulse меряет силу самого движения (моментум, нормированный волатильностью) и его направление. Это про «насколько мощный ход», а не про «дорого или дёшево».
Что показывает маркер «энергия гаснет»?
Точку, когда при неизменном знаке энергии и её среднее, и сама энергия одновременно разворачиваются к нулю - движение выдыхается. Это подсказка подтянуть стоп или зафиксировать часть позиции, а не сигнал на разворот.
Это торговый робот?
Нет. Это дискреционный индикатор-помощник: он измеряет энергию хода, рисует сигналы и даёт вердикт ДЕЙСТВИЕ, но сам сделки не открывает. Решение и управление риском остаются за трейдером.
Это клон Awesome Oscillator или SharpOS?
Нет. Идея «входить по набравшему энергию движению» взята из подхода SharpOS, но математика оригинальная и полностью открытая: моментум / ATR, EMA-сглаживание, адаптивная нормализация в [-1;+1] и два MA-фильтра. Это не пересказ чужой формулы.
На каком таймфрейме работает?
На любом - логика от таймфрейма не зависит. Рабочий по стеку - M5 на золоте. Период сглаживания и нормировки настраиваются, поэтому чувствительность можно подстроить под свой ТФ и инструмент.
Доступ
Доступ к индикатору - по запросу в Telegram @AlgoSynergy. Там же отвечу на вопросы по настройке и математике.
Материал носит образовательный характер и не является инвестиционной рекомендацией. Торговля сопряжена с риском потери капитала.